Strategic Ambition and Betrayal

Evil-Lyn serves as Skeletor's primary lieutenant, distinguished by an intellect that far surpasses his other minions. While she openly acknowledges that her raw magical power does not yet equal her master's, she harbors a secret ambition to usurp him and rule Eternia independently. This treacherous motivation drives much of her behavior; she frequently operates outside Skeletor's direct command, executing schemes solely for personal gain rather than loyalty to Snake Mountain. Her lack of devotion is explicitly confirmed in the animated series, where she admits to Teela that she works for Skeletor only as a means to eventually steal his superior abilities. This pattern of betrayal culminates in the 1987 live-action film, where she abandons her master after he absorbs universal power without sharing it with her. Unlike other villains who remain subservient, Evil-Lyn consistently demonstrates that her allegiance is conditional, making her a volatile and self-serving force within the evil hierarchy.

Magical Mastery and Independence

As an evil witch, Evil-Lyn possesses formidable magical capabilities that often render physical weapons unnecessary. Although she carries a trademark wand crowned with a crystal orb, this artifact serves more as a symbol than a requirement; she typically generates potent spells directly from her own internal reservoir of dark energy. Her expertise allows her to manipulate reality through disguises and illusions, effectively duping heroes in various episodes without relying on external artifacts like the Shaping Staff or Spellstone, though she will use them when advantageous. In the cartoon series, she is portrayed not as a warrior but as a sorceress whose power compensates for any lack of combat skills, acting as a dark mirror to the Sorceress rather than Teela. Her magic is versatile and self-sufficient, enabling her to conduct complex operations independently or aid other villains like Gorgon and Dark-Dream when her own interests align with theirs.

Character Evolution Across Media

Evil-Lyn's portrayal has shifted significantly depending on the medium, evolving from a toy design concept into a nuanced character study. Originally introduced in 1983 as an evil warrior-goddess counterpart to Teela, her action figure featured bright yellow skin and was visually identical to her heroic rival aside from color schemes. However, the Filmation cartoon reimagined her as a refined intellectual with no warrior skills, voiced by Linda Gary to convey both perniciousness and elegance. The 1987 live-action film further altered her dynamic, introducing a romantic subtext between her and Skeletor where she acts as his calming influence against his hysteria. Despite these changes, the core trait of her scheming nature remains constant. Even when the show's bible proposed an origin story involving a jealous Earth scientist named Evelyn Powers, this backstory was largely ignored in favor of focusing on her established role as a powerful, independent sorceress.

Complex Relationships and Moments of Mercy

Despite her villainous reputation, Evil-Lyn displays unexpected complexity in her interactions with others, particularly regarding Teela. In the episode 'The Witch and the Warrior,' she is forced into an uneasy alliance with Teela while stranded in a desert. Initially holding Teela in contempt, Evil-Lyn eventually develops genuine respect for her skills, suggesting they could form a formidable team. This arc reveals that she values competence over blind loyalty. Furthermore, after being saved by Mallek the Wizard of Stone Mountain, she demonstrates shades of goodness by refusing to steal an item Skeletor demanded, telling him to retrieve it himself. These moments highlight that while she is driven by power, she possesses a moral code distinct from her master's cruelty. Her ability to show gratitude and acknowledge respect in adversaries proves she is not merely a subservient henchman but a multifaceted individual with her own agency.
